Museu
da Música
One of Portugal's most recent museums, dedicated to music, contains
a rich heritage including 700 musical intruments, together with valuable
specialised literature.

Museu
da Rádio
Free Entry - Tram : 28 - 20 exhibition rooms featuring more than 1000
radios from the 20s till the 70s, radio studios, broadcasting equipment,
library, ...

Museu
de Arte Popular
Ceramics, furniture, wickerwork, and paintings from around the country
: Algarve, Alentejo, Estremadura, Beira, Trás-os-Montes, Minho
and Entre Douro.

Museu
de Ciência
Conceived as an institution that presents scientific knowledge to
general audiences, mainly devoted to public understanding of the importance
of Science, not only as the base of technology, but also as an essential
part of our contemporary culture.
